Tentativa de instalar o Ubuntu, agora não tenho menu de inicialização

1

Eu tentei instalar o Ubuntu 13.04 no meu disco rígido secundário. Digo "tentativa" porque tive que cancelar a instalação depois que ela ficou pendurada no "update-grub" (ou algo parecido) por duas ou três horas. Eu não imaginei que alguma vez fosse conseguir algo realizado, então eu matei o poder e liguei novamente. Agora eu recebo uma mensagem na inicialização que lê,

  

erro: arquivo '/grub/i386-pc/normal.mod' não encontrado

e me dá um prompt de comando que não tenho idéia do que fazer com. Eu tenho um disco rígido principal executando o Windows 7, e eu estava tentando instalar o Ubuntu em uma unidade secundária no meu computador. A instalação deve ter instalado ou tentado instalar o GRUB na minha partição do Windows, já que é a unidade que o meu computador inicializa.

Na solução do problema, tentei o seguinte sem sucesso:

   ubuntu @ ubuntu: ~ $ sudo mount / dev / sda1 / mnt

      ubuntu @ ubuntu: ~ $ grub-install / dev / sda - diretório raiz = / mnt

Resultando na mensagem

  

O caminho '/ mnt / boot / grub' não é legível pelo GRUB na inicialização. A instalação é impossível. Abortando.

Isso provavelmente ocorreu porque / sda1 é a partição do Windows 7. Eu realmente não entendo como ou onde o GRUB foi realmente instalado, ou como / onde eu preciso tentar atualizá-lo. Então tentei a partição linux, / sdb1

   ubuntu @ ubuntu: ~ $ sudo mount / dev / sdb1 / / mnt

      ubuntu @ ubuntu: ~ $ grub-install / dev / sda - diretório raiz = / mnt

Que retornou

  

rm: não é possível remover "/mnt/boot/grub/i386-pc/915resolution.mod": Permissão negada

Então, agora estou perdido. Estou enviando isso do LiveCD do Ubuntu porque não tenho como fazer login no Windows 7 ou na partição Linux que pode ou não ter sido criada - não tenho ideia a essa altura, porque não consegui tente e inicialize nele.

Qualquer ajuda seria muito apreciada.

Obrigado antecipadamente.

    
por Chris 22.05.2013 / 06:12

1 resposta

1

Você precisa usar o prompt de comando do GRUB para inicializar o sistema Ubuntu instalado primeiro. Leia a seção "Inicializando o Ubuntu instalado em partições de disco" neste manual:

link

Com base na sua configuração do HDD, eu acho que seus comandos devem ser os seguintes:

set root=(hd1,msdos1)
linux /boot/vmlinux-3.8.0-19-generic ro root=/dev/sdb1
initrd /boot/initrd.img-3.8.0-19-generic
boot

Nos nomes de arquivo exatos, você sempre pode usar a tecla [TAB] .

ATUALIZAÇÃO: Siga este procedimento para reinstalar:

1. Disconnect the first HDD (Windows)
2. Install Ubuntu in the usual way
3. Download and burn the Boot-Repair ISO to a CD.
4. Reconnect the first drive.
5. Boot into the Boot-Repair CD and run the recommended repair.
    
por grimpitch 22.05.2013 / 06:49